How can I tell when a MySQL table was last updated?
...e information_schema database to tell you when another table was updated:
SELECT UPDATE_TIME
FROM information_schema.tables
WHERE TABLE_SCHEMA = 'dbname'
AND TABLE_NAME = 'tabname'
This does of course mean opening a connection to the database.
